


Core Insights - The automotive industry is experiencing a significant performance divergence among companies in the first half of 2025, with some achieving growth in both revenue and net profit, while others face declines in both metrics [1][4]. Revenue and Profit Performance - Among 16 A/H share listed automotive companies, 11 reported revenue growth, and 9 achieved profitability, with over half of the companies being profitable [1][4]. - BYD leads the industry with revenue of 371.281 billion yuan, a year-on-year increase of 23.3%, and a net profit of 15.511 billion yuan, up 13.79% [3][4]. - Traditional automakers like Geely, Great Wall, and SAIC maintained net profits above 6 billion yuan, but all experienced approximately 10% declines in net profit [1][4][5]. - The overall automotive industry revenue reached 509.17 billion yuan, a year-on-year increase of 8%, while costs rose by 9% to 447.8 billion yuan, resulting in a profit of 24.44 billion yuan, up 3.6% [4]. Company-Specific Insights - Geely's revenue grew by 27% to 150.285 billion yuan, but net profit fell by 13.9% to 9.29 billion yuan, attributed to a previous asset sale in 2024 [4][5]. - Great Wall's revenue was 92.335 billion yuan, a slight increase of 0.99%, with net profit declining by 10.21% to 6.337 billion yuan [5]. - Changan, Dongfeng, and GAC faced performance pressures due to challenges in joint ventures, with Changan's revenue down 5.25% to 72.691 billion yuan and net profit down 19.09% to 2.291 billion yuan [5][6][7]. - GAC reported a revenue decline of 7.95% to 42.166 billion yuan and a net loss of 2.538 billion yuan, a significant drop of 267.39% [7]. New Energy Vehicle Collaborations - Companies collaborating with Huawei on the "Five Realms" brand, particularly Seres, have shown significant performance improvements, with Seres achieving a net profit increase of 81.03% to 2.941 billion yuan [8][9]. - Other companies like BAIC Blue Valley and Jianghuai faced challenges, with Jianghuai's revenue down 9.1% to 19.36 billion yuan and a net loss of 777 million yuan, marking a 356.89% decline [9]. Emerging Players Performance - Among the new energy vehicle startups, Li Auto continues to lead with a revenue of 56.17 billion yuan, down 2%, and a net profit of 1.743 billion yuan, up 2.8% [13][14]. - Xpeng and NIO reported revenues of 34.09 billion yuan and 31.043 billion yuan, respectively, with Xpeng showing a significant growth of 132.51% [13][14]. - Leap Motor achieved its first half-year profit of 33 million yuan, while NIO and Xpeng continue to struggle with profitability [13][14]. Market Trends and Future Outlook - The overall market is seeing a shift towards high-end models, with Seres' high-end models leading sales in their respective price segments [8]. - Companies are focusing on cost control and operational efficiency to improve profitability, with NIO implementing a comprehensive cost reduction plan [14].
